Biography
Bridgit Claire Mendler (born December 18, 1992) is an American actress, singer-songwriter, musician and producer. She is best known for her lead role as Teddy Duncan on the Disney Channel Original Series Good Luck Charlie, her recurring role as Juliet Van Heusen on Wizards of Waverly Place and her lead role as Olivia on the Disney Channel Original Movie Lemonade Mouth. She has also appeared in Labor Pains, Alvin and the Chipmunks: The Squeakquel and Beverly Hills Chihuahua 2. In 2015 she joined the main cast of the NBC sitcom Undateable as Candace, which aired until 2016. In 2019, she starred on Netflix's Merry Happy Whatever as Emmy Quinn. Aside from her artistic career, Bridgit also has a master's degree on MIT and is currently working on JD in Harvard Law School and PhD on MIT.
